Start with a Soft, Neutral Foundation

One of the easiest ways to create a peaceful bedroom is by choosing a warm neutral color palette. Cream, soft white, greige, and warm beige provide a timeless backdrop while making the room feel brighter and larger.
Once your foundation is in place, it's easy to refresh the room seasonally with pillows, throws, or artwork.

Layer Bedding Like a Luxury Hotel

Nothing transforms a bedroom faster than beautifully layered bedding.
Start with crisp white sheets, add a fluffy duvet, fold a textured throw across the foot of the bed, and finish with pillows in different fabrics like linen, cotton, and bouclé.
The room immediately feels warm, inviting, and luxurious.

Add Warm Lighting Throughout the Room

The right lighting makes every bedroom feel more relaxing.
Instead of relying only on overhead fixtures, add bedside lamps, wall sconces, and warm LED bulbs to create a cozy atmosphere throughout the evening.
Soft lighting is one of the easiest ways to make a bedroom feel more expensive.

Mix Natural Materials

Great bedrooms combine different textures that feel warm and welcoming.
Mix wood, linen, woven baskets, ceramic accessories, natural stone, and soft textiles to give the room depth without creating clutter.
Natural materials never go out of style.

Decorate with Fewer, Better Pieces

Instead of filling every surface, choose meaningful decor that adds personality.
A stack of favorite books, handmade pottery, framed photography, or a small vase of greenery creates a finished look while keeping the room peaceful.
Timeless bedrooms always prioritize quality over quantity.
